Scheduling Direct Acyclic Graphs on Massively Parallel 1K-core Processors
Uloženo v:
| Název: | Scheduling Direct Acyclic Graphs on Massively Parallel 1K-core Processors |
|---|---|
| Autoři: | Ke Yue, Ioan Raicu |
| Přispěvatelé: | The Pennsylvania State University CiteSeerX Archives |
| Zdroj: | http://datasys.cs.iit.edu/reports/2014_IIT-1K-cores.pdf. |
| Sbírka: | CiteSeerX |
| Témata: | KEY WORDS, NoC, Many Task Computing, Scheduling |
| Popis: | The era of manycore computing will bring new fundamental challenges that the techniques designed for single core processors will have to be dramatically changed to support the coming wave of extreme-scale computing with thousands of cores on a single processor. Today’s programming languages (e.g. C/C++, Java) are unlikely to scale to manycore levels. One approach to address such concurrency problem is to look at many-task computing (MTC). Many MTC applications are structured as graphs of discrete tasks, with explicit input and output dependencies forming the directed edges. We designed both static and dynamic schedulers for such MTC applications, scalable to 1K-cores. The simulation study by using a cycle accurate NoC simulator shows that the proposed strategy result in 85 % shorter makespan and 90 % higher utilization in comparison to random mapping. In addition, our heuristic can tolerate variance of the tasks ’ execution times at runtime and deliver improved makespan and utilization. |
| Druh dokumentu: | text |
| Popis souboru: | application/pdf |
| Jazyk: | English |
| Relation: | http://citeseerx.ist.psu.edu/viewdoc/summary?doi=10.1.1.646.975 |
| Dostupnost: | http://citeseerx.ist.psu.edu/viewdoc/summary?doi=10.1.1.646.975 http://datasys.cs.iit.edu/reports/2014_IIT-1K-cores.pdf |
| Rights: | Metadata may be used without restrictions as long as the oai identifier remains attached to it. |
| Přístupové číslo: | edsbas.66201F4 |
| Databáze: | BASE |
| FullText | Text: Availability: 0 CustomLinks: – Url: http://citeseerx.ist.psu.edu/viewdoc/summary?doi=10.1.1.646.975# Name: EDS - BASE (s4221598) Category: fullText Text: View record from BASE – Url: https://www.webofscience.com/api/gateway?GWVersion=2&SrcApp=EBSCO&SrcAuth=EBSCO&DestApp=WOS&ServiceName=TransferToWoS&DestLinkType=GeneralSearchSummary&Func=Links&author=Yue%20K Name: ISI Category: fullText Text: Nájsť tento článok vo Web of Science Icon: https://imagesrvr.epnet.com/ls/20docs.gif MouseOverText: Nájsť tento článok vo Web of Science |
|---|---|
| Header | DbId: edsbas DbLabel: BASE An: edsbas.66201F4 RelevancyScore: 750 AccessLevel: 3 PubType: Academic Journal PubTypeId: academicJournal PreciseRelevancyScore: 750 |
| IllustrationInfo | |
| Items | – Name: Title Label: Title Group: Ti Data: Scheduling Direct Acyclic Graphs on Massively Parallel 1K-core Processors – Name: Author Label: Authors Group: Au Data: <searchLink fieldCode="AR" term="%22Ke+Yue%22">Ke Yue</searchLink><br /><searchLink fieldCode="AR" term="%22Ioan+Raicu%22">Ioan Raicu</searchLink> – Name: Author Label: Contributors Group: Au Data: The Pennsylvania State University CiteSeerX Archives – Name: TitleSource Label: Source Group: Src Data: <i>http://datasys.cs.iit.edu/reports/2014_IIT-1K-cores.pdf</i>. – Name: Subset Label: Collection Group: HoldingsInfo Data: CiteSeerX – Name: Subject Label: Subject Terms Group: Su Data: <searchLink fieldCode="DE" term="%22KEY+WORDS%22">KEY WORDS</searchLink><br /><searchLink fieldCode="DE" term="%22NoC%22">NoC</searchLink><br /><searchLink fieldCode="DE" term="%22Many+Task+Computing%22">Many Task Computing</searchLink><br /><searchLink fieldCode="DE" term="%22Scheduling%22">Scheduling</searchLink> – Name: Abstract Label: Description Group: Ab Data: The era of manycore computing will bring new fundamental challenges that the techniques designed for single core processors will have to be dramatically changed to support the coming wave of extreme-scale computing with thousands of cores on a single processor. Today’s programming languages (e.g. C/C++, Java) are unlikely to scale to manycore levels. One approach to address such concurrency problem is to look at many-task computing (MTC). Many MTC applications are structured as graphs of discrete tasks, with explicit input and output dependencies forming the directed edges. We designed both static and dynamic schedulers for such MTC applications, scalable to 1K-cores. The simulation study by using a cycle accurate NoC simulator shows that the proposed strategy result in 85 % shorter makespan and 90 % higher utilization in comparison to random mapping. In addition, our heuristic can tolerate variance of the tasks ’ execution times at runtime and deliver improved makespan and utilization. – Name: TypeDocument Label: Document Type Group: TypDoc Data: text – Name: Format Label: File Description Group: SrcInfo Data: application/pdf – Name: Language Label: Language Group: Lang Data: English – Name: NoteTitleSource Label: Relation Group: SrcInfo Data: http://citeseerx.ist.psu.edu/viewdoc/summary?doi=10.1.1.646.975 – Name: URL Label: Availability Group: URL Data: http://citeseerx.ist.psu.edu/viewdoc/summary?doi=10.1.1.646.975<br />http://datasys.cs.iit.edu/reports/2014_IIT-1K-cores.pdf – Name: Copyright Label: Rights Group: Cpyrght Data: Metadata may be used without restrictions as long as the oai identifier remains attached to it. – Name: AN Label: Accession Number Group: ID Data: edsbas.66201F4 |
| PLink | https://erproxy.cvtisr.sk/sfx/access?url=https://search.ebscohost.com/login.aspx?direct=true&site=eds-live&db=edsbas&AN=edsbas.66201F4 |
| RecordInfo | BibRecord: BibEntity: Languages: – Text: English Subjects: – SubjectFull: KEY WORDS Type: general – SubjectFull: NoC Type: general – SubjectFull: Many Task Computing Type: general – SubjectFull: Scheduling Type: general Titles: – TitleFull: Scheduling Direct Acyclic Graphs on Massively Parallel 1K-core Processors Type: main BibRelationships: HasContributorRelationships: – PersonEntity: Name: NameFull: Ke Yue – PersonEntity: Name: NameFull: Ioan Raicu – PersonEntity: Name: NameFull: The Pennsylvania State University CiteSeerX Archives IsPartOfRelationships: – BibEntity: Identifiers: – Type: issn-locals Value: edsbas – Type: issn-locals Value: edsbas.oa Titles: – TitleFull: http://datasys.cs.iit.edu/reports/2014_IIT-1K-cores.pdf Type: main |
| ResultId | 1 |
Nájsť tento článok vo Web of Science